As in each condition, there are specified conditions You need to meet up with prior to deciding to can file for divorce. As a way to file for your Texas divorce, one or the two companions needs to have lived in Texas for at least six months and inside the county wherever the divorce is submitted for a minimum of ninety times.

As long as you Keep to the state's relationship license guidelines, you can obtain married in any condition—even if you do not Dwell there. The necessities for ending a relationship, however, aren't as comfortable. Rather, it's essential to satisfy a point out's residency specifications before you decide to can file for divorce in its courts.
